Download Sample Ask For Discount Japan Stainless Steel Medical Wire Market By Type Segment Analysis The Japan stainless steel medical wire market is primarily classified into several key types based on alloy composition, manufacturing process, and intended medical application. The most prevalent types include 304, 316L, and other specialty stainless steels such as 321 and 410. Among these, 316L stainless steel dominates due to its superior corrosion resistance, biocompatibility, and mechanical strength, making it the preferred choice for surgical instruments, guidewires, and implantable devices. The market size for stainless steel medical wires in Japan was estimated at approximately USD 150 million in 2023, with a compound annual growth rate (CAGR) of around 4.5% projected over the next five years. This growth is driven by increasing demand for minimally invasive procedures and the expanding portfolio of medical devices requiring high-quality stainless steel components. The fastest-growing segment within this market is the specialty stainless steel wires, such as 321 and 410 grades, which are gaining traction for their enhanced strength and specific application suitability, including orthopedic and dental devices. These specialty wires are still in the emerging growth stage but are expected to see accelerated adoption owing to technological advancements and customized manufacturing capabilities. The market for 304 and 316L types is reaching a growth saturation point, reflecting their established status in the industry. Japan Stainless Steel Medical Wire Market By Application Segment Analysis The application landscape for stainless steel medical wires in Japan encompasses a broad spectrum of medical devices, including guidewires, surgical instruments, stents, orthodontic wires, and implantable devices. Guidewires represent the largest segment, accounting for approximately 45% of the total market in 2023, driven by the rising adoption of minimally invasive procedures such as angioplasty and endoscopy. Surgical instruments utilizing stainless steel wires, including forceps, scissors, and needle components, constitute around 30% of the market, benefiting from Japan’s advanced healthcare infrastructure and emphasis on precision engineering. Orthodontic and dental wires, though smaller in volume, are experiencing steady growth due to increasing dental health awareness and cosmetic dentistry trends. The market size for these applications was estimated at USD 150 million in 2023, with a CAGR of approximately 4.5%, aligning with the overall market growth trajectory. The fastest-growing application segment is the implantable device sector, including vascular stents and orthopedic implants, which is witnessing rapid innovation and regulatory approval processes. These devices demand high-performance stainless steel wires with enhanced strength, corrosion resistance, and surface finish. The growth stage of guidewires and surgical instruments is mature, with steady demand driven by ongoing procedural volume. Conversely, the implantable device segment is emerging, with significant growth potential fueled by technological breakthroughs and an aging population requiring advanced therapeutic solutions.
